Ferry services on key river routes resume after over 3 hrs

Ferry operations on the Aricha-Kazirhat and Paturia-Daulatdia routes resumed on Saturday morning after  three and a half hours of suspension due to dense fog.


Bangladesh Inland Water Transport Corporation (BIWTC) Aricha sector Deputy General Manager Abdus Salam said ferry services resumed around 7:30 am.

He said the decision to halt operations was taken to avoid navigational hazards caused by poor visibility due to thick fog.

Ferries named Motiur Rahman and Enayetpuri were among those stranded during the disruption.

Four ferries with passengers and vehicles were stranded at the Paturia terminal while three others remained stuck at the Daulatdia terminal, reports UNB.
